Focuses on moist wound healing concepts through the use of 25 case studies and videos featuring Kendall Advanced Wound Care products. This CD-ROM includes four videos that feature dressing placement and splint application. It is designed to assist the student or practitioner with general wound care in horses.
Wound Care Management assists with general wound care in horses. It includes basic wound cleaning and preparation, important anatomical considerations, moist healing concepts, dressing choices, and specific wounds by body region. Along with detailed sections about wound closure techniques using bandaging and skin grafting there is in-depth discussion of appropriate wound dressing used for cleaning, debridement, packing, absorption, compression, support, and protection. The book emphases important anatomical considerations by body regions in a highly visual format (70 color photos, 100 figures).
